Applebee’s Chicken Quesadilla – Copycat Recipe
Enjoy the taste of Applebee’s Chicken Quesadilla right at home! This easy and delicious copycat recipe features tender chicken, melted cheese, and fresh veggies, all wrapped in a crispy tortilla. Perfect for a quick lunch or dinner!

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
- 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or Mexican blend)
- 1/2 cup red b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 cup onion, diced
- 1 tsp taco seasoning
- 4 large flour tortillas
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- Sour cream and salsa for serving
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ine shredded chicken, cheese, red bell pepper, onion, and taco seasoning.
-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
- Place one tortilla in the skillet, and spread 1/4 of the chicken mixture on one half of the tortilla.
- Fold the tortilla over and cook until golden brown, about 3-4 minutes per side. Repeat with remaining tortillas and filling.
- Cut each quesadilla into wedges and serve with sour cream and salsa.

Handy Tips
- Pre-cook the chicken for extra flavor; grilling or baking works well.
- Feel free to add other vegetables like corn or black beans for variety.
- Use a non-stick skillet for easier flipping and less oil needed.
Ingredient Swaps
- Chicken: Use shredded rotisserie chicken for convenience.
- Cheese: Substitute with pepper jack cheese for a spicy kick.
- Tortillas: Whole wheat tortillas can be used for a healthier option.
